How Can Social Bookmarking Boost Your SEO Game?

Here’s the thing, Google loves it when people engage with content naturally, and social bookmarking can be a tiny boost in that direction. When you add your link to a social bookmarking site, it creates a backlink — which, yes, is like a little vote of confidence for your site. But it’s not just about links; it’s about traffic. People browsing these platforms might stumble upon your content and spend time on it, which tells search engines, Hey, this is worth showing! It’s kind of like having a friend recommend a movie; it instantly feels more credible than some random ad. And honestly, in the world of SEO, credibility is king.

Are There Any Risks You Should Know About?

Here’s a little reality check — not all social bookmarking is magical. If you spam your links everywhere without adding value, it can backfire. Search engines aren’t dumb; they can tell when you’re just tossing links around. The goal should be to genuinely share content that people will find useful or entertaining. Think of it like throwing a party — you wouldn’t just invite random strangers and expect everyone to have fun. You want the right crowd, the right vibe, and maybe some fun snacks. Online, your snacks are helpful tips, engaging stories, or cool visuals.
